§ 39.35 leak testing of sealed sources Leak testing suntrac offers a convenient, simple method for meeting the requirements of agreement state regulations for control of radiation and nrc regulations (10 cfr 39.35) for leak testing of sealed sources (a) testing and recordkeeping requirements

Each licensee who uses a sealed source shall have the source tested for leakage periodically One for fixed type nuclear gauges, the other for portable nuclear density/moisture gauges. The licensee shall keep a record of leak test results in units of microcuries and retain the record for inspection by the commission for 3 years after the leak test is performed

Radiation leak testing is a specialized procedure designed to detect any release of radioactive material from sealed sources, devices, or containers

Even though these sources are designed to be secure, wear and tear, damage, or manufacturing defects can result in leaks over time Early detection of leaks is critical to prevent contamination, health hazards, and regulatory violations A radiation leak is the unintended release of radioactive materials or energy into the environment Understanding their nature and consequences is important for public safety

Leak testing training regular leak testing is essential for ensuring the safe use of sealed radioactive sources By following the correct procedures and maintaining compliance, organizations can prevent hazardous exposure and avoid regulatory penalties. The major types of ionizing radiation emitted during radioactive decay are alpha particles, beta particles and gamma rays

If the leak test reveals the presence of 0.005 uci or more of removable contamination contact the radiation safety office immediately The rso shall immediately inform the state radiation control program office by telephone, withdraw the sealed source use, and place it in locked storage.
